Lucas De Bolle is a 23-year-old football player who plays as a midfielder for Portimonense, born on October 22, 2002, who is right-footed. Lucas De Bolle's career has also included time at South Shields, Newcastle United, and Hamilton Academical.
On the international stage, Lucas De Bolle has represented Scotland U21.

Throughout their career, Lucas De Bolle has won 1 title: Challenge Cup (2022/2023) with Hamilton Academical.
